Coach of the team "Budivelnik" Kiev – USSR Champion 1988.

Bronze Medalist of the USSR Championship 1987, 1989.

Trainee Coach with Head Coach Dick Bennett in University of Wisconsin 1989-1990.

Head of International Basketball Operations, NBA Minnesota Timberwolves 1991-1997.

Vice-President of Basketball Operations of the Basketball Club “Athletas” Kaunas – the champion of the regular championship of the Lithuanian Basketball League 1995-96.

Prepared and brought to the NBA by Zhidrunas Ilgauskas, a member of the NBA All Star Game, Virginius Prašiuvicius (Timberwolves, Nikita Morgunov (Portland).

Coach of the Gent team, Super League, Belgium.

Sports director of the club "Dynamo" Moscow – Bronze medalist of the 1998 Russian Championship.

Assistant to the sports director of the Varese club (brought Pavel Podkolzin to Italy and further to the NBA) 1999/2000.

Coach of the Ukrainian national basketball team, which for the first time in history reached the final of the European Championship in 2002.

Coach of the "Stockholm-08" team – 2005-2006.

Coach of the Livu team, Alus, Latvia.

He brought Olumide Oideji to Russia and further to the NBA.
